Output 9055383de6f8edae8b3b7697ff0869305c8169c94b8c4629b120048a999f999e:1

value
20148464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809e0887936736c368d29a89bd7fda49ac7517ce OP_EQUAL
address
MKdE3LCz1W2wDxZchgAzL1SKEohqRmXg5A
transaction
9055383de6f8edae8b3b7697ff0869305c8169c94b8c4629b120048a999f999e
spent
true